Niederwaldkirchner cyclists shine at Pöstlingberg Classic 2025!

On Thursday, May 29, the 2nd Pöstlingberg Classic 2nd Pöstlingberg Classic took place in Linz. This event, which invited to the determination of the Upper Austrian state championships in mining, attracted numerous cyclists and spectators. The route of 4.6 kilometers with around 270 meters of altitude led from Linz's main square to the Pöstlingberg, a well -known landmark that is famous for its steep climb and the striking silhouette.

The association next125 hackl habitos was represented with a strong troop. Rene Pammer from St. Johann prevailed in the amateur race and was celebrated as the winner. Christian Oberngruber from Putzleinsdorf took second place and also showed an impressive performance.

But these were not the only successes: other athletes from the association also made it into the top ranks. Florian Bauer landed in 14th place, followed by Daniel Klug in 20th place and Felix Graf, who rolled over the finish line as 23. In the Master 1 class, Harald Hofer from Feldkirchen was able to look forward to second place-a remarkable success in his debut. Andreas Paster from Julbach dominated the Master 2–3 category and secured first place ahead of Thomas Mairhofer with an impressive lead of 23 seconds.

The event became a success despite the inconsistent weather situation: during the race it stayed dry and the pleasantly mild temperatures created ideal conditions for the athletes.
